Patchwork-Familie
/ˈpɛtʃvɜːk faˈmiːliə/
Blended family
When to use it
Modern, neutral German term for a family with step-parents and step-siblings. Increasingly common.
In conversation
—Wir sind eine Patchwork-Familie mit fünf Kindern.
“—We're a blended family with five kids.”
